Cost of Production and Cost Curves
- Cost of Production: The total expense incurred in producing a certain quantity of a product. It includes costs of inputs like raw materials, labor, rent, etc.
- Explicit Costs: Direct payments made to others (e.g., wages, rent, materials).
- Implicit Costs: Indirect, non-cash costs (e.g., the owner's opportunity cost of their own time or resources).
- Fixed Costs (FC): Costs that do not change with the level of output (e.g., rent, salaries).
- Variable Costs (VC): Costs that vary directly with the level of production (e.g., raw materials).
- Total Cost (TC): Sum of fixed and variable costs.
Concepts of Cost
At the core of economic production is the concept of cost. Simply put, cost is the total expense incurred to create goods or services. Understanding different types of costs enables businesses to make smarter decisions and enhance their production processes.
Fixed Costs
Fixed costs are expenses that remain unchanged regardless of how much is produced. For example, companies consistently pay rent for their facilities and salaries for employees, even if production slows down. According to industry data, fixed costs can constitute up to 70% of a firm's total expenses in the services sector.
This consistency in fixed costs creates a necessary baseline that companies must cover, impacting pricing and profitability.
Variable Costs
Variable costs, in contrast, fluctuate depending on production levels. They rise when production increases and fall when production decreases. For example, a bakery sees its variable costs rise with the purchase of additional flour and sugar as it bakes more bread. Reports indicate that in manufacturing, variable costs can represent about 50% of the total cost structure.
Being aware of variable costs is crucial for businesses to set prices effectively and manage profit margins. As production ramps up, tracking these costs helps in maintaining financial health.
Total Costs
Total costs combine both fixed and variable costs, giving a complete picture of what it costs to produce a certain level of output. This calculation is essential for determining pricing strategies, assessing profitability, and performing cost-benefit analyses.
Opportunity Cost
Opportunity cost is another vital yet often overlooked aspect of production. It represents the value of the best alternative forgone when a choice is made. For example, if a farmer decides to plant wheat instead of corn, the opportunity cost is the potential profit they miss from not planting corn. Understanding these costs encourages businesses to evaluate whether their resources are allocated wisely.
Recognizing these different cost types is crucial for effective decision-making and improving operational efficiency.

Understanding Short-Run and Long-Run Costs
The concepts of short-run and long-run costs are essential for understanding how firms manage their production and cost structures.
Short-Run Costs
In the short run, certain factors remain fixed while others vary. Businesses can adjust some inputs, like labor and materials, but they cannot change fixed inputs such as factory size. As production ramps up, companies often face diminishing returns, which can lead to rising average costs. For instance, if a factory operates at 70% capacity, its average cost per unit may decrease, but beyond a certain point, costs might start to increase.
Long-Run Costs
In the long run, all production factors become variable. Businesses can change equipment, expand facilities, or alter workforce sizes, making them more adaptable to market changes. The long-run average cost curve (LRAC) highlights the lowest cost per unit across different output levels when all inputs can vary. This curve typically shows economies of scale at lower production levels and diseconomies of scale when production is stretched too far.
Understanding the difference between short-run and long-run costs is crucial for strategic planning. Companies must balance short-term cost minimization with long-term efficiency and growth potential.
Economies of Scale: Internal and External
As companies grow, they can benefit from economies of scale, which can substantially affect their cost structures and competitive edge. Economies of scale fall into two categories: internal and external.
Internal Economies of Scale
Internal economies of scale occur within a company and arise from efficiencies gained as it expands. Examples include:
- Technical Efficiencies: Larger firms can invest in modern technologies that lead to greater production efficiency, lowering the cost per unit. Companies like Ford saw costs drop by over 20% as they optimized assembly line processes.
- Managerial Efficiencies: With growth, firms can hire specialists for management roles, improving operation efficiency and decision-making.
- Bulk Purchasing: Larger firms often secure better prices from suppliers as they buy in bulk, leading to lower raw material costs.
External Economies of Scale
In contrast, external economies benefit all businesses within a sector and arise from industry-wide growth:
- Supplier Networks: As an industry expands, suppliers often establish improvements to deliver their goods more efficiently, benefiting all firms with lower supply costs.
- Infrastructure Development: A booming industry can lead to improved transportation and utilities, which helps all companies involved.
- Workforce Skills: An industry's growth can attract skilled workers, subsequently decreasing training costs for all firms, as the labor pool becomes more specialized.
Understanding both internal and external economies of scale allows businesses to leverage growth opportunities effectively.
